How it works

Family Reach navigation links patients to resources that can reduce costs associated with cancer treatment. The program is delivered by our team of in-house navigators who communicate directly with patients, caregivers, and the oncology care team.

The three-step navigation process

 
  1. A financial needs assessment
  2. Matching the patient needs to resources
  3. Referring patients to resources.

Navigation to resources within the Family Reach Ecosystem can reduce spending on travel, temporary lodging, housing, utilities and more. When appropriate, referrals are made to external organizations to provide additional support or to reduce out-of-pocket medical costs including co-payment assistance.
